#d9643b - Red Damask Hex Color Code

#D9643B (Red Damask) - RGB 217, 100, 59 Color Information

#d9643b Conversion Table

HEX Triplet D9, 64, 3B
RGB Decimal 217, 100, 59
RGB Octal 331, 144, 73
RGB Percent 85.1%, 39.2%, 23.1%
RGB Binary 11011001, 1100100, 111011
CMY 0.149, 0.608, 0.769
CMYK 0, 54, 73, 15

Color spaces of #D9643B Red Damask - RGB(217, 100, 59)

HSV (or HSB) 16°, 73°, 85°
HSL 16°, 68°, 54°
Web Safe #cc6633
XYZ 33.962, 24.182, 7.015
CIE-Lab 56.269, 43.297, 44.424
xyY 0.521, 0.371, 24.182
Decimal 14246971

#d9643b - RGB(217, 100, 59) - Red Damask Color FAQ

What is the color code for Red Damask?

Hex color code for Red Damask color is #d9643b. RGB color code for red damask color is rgb(217, 100, 59).

What is the RGB value of #d9643b?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#d9643b is rgb(217, 100, 59).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'217' indicates the intensity of the red component, '100' represents the green component's intensity, and '59'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#d9643b.

What is the RGB percentage of #d9643b?

The RGB percentage composition for the hexadecimal color code #d9643b is detailed as follows: 85.1% Red, 39.2% Green, and 23.1% Blue. This breakdown indicates the relative contribution of each primary color in the RGB color model to achieve this specific shade. The value 85.1% for Red signifies a dominant red component, contributing significantly to the overall color. The Green and Blue components are comparatively lower, with 39.2% and 23.1% respectively, playing a smaller role in the composition of this particular hue. Together, these percentages of Red, Green, and Blue mix to form the distinct color represented by #d9643b.

What does RGB 217,100,59 mean?

The RGB color 217, 100, 59 represents a dull and muted shade of Red. The websafe version of this color is hex cc6633.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Red Damask.

What is the C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) color model of #d9643b?

In the C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Black)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#d9643b is composed of 0% Cyan, 54% Magenta, 73% Yellow, and 15% Black. In this CMYK breakdown, the Cyan component at 0% influences the coolness or green-blue aspects of the color, whereas the 54% of Magenta contributes to the red-purple qualities. The 73% of Yellow typically adds to the brightness and warmth, and the 15% of Black determines the depth and overall darkness of the shade. The resulting color can range from bright and vivid to deep and muted, depending on these CMYK values. The CMYK color model is crucial in color printing and graphic design, offering a practical way to mix these four ink colors to create a vast spectrum of hues.

What is the HSL value of #d9643b?

In the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#d9643b has an HSL value of 16° (degrees) for Hue, 68% for Saturation, and 54% for Lightness. In this HSL representation, the Hue at 16° indicates the basic color tone, which is a shade of red in this case. The Saturation value of 68% describes the intensity or purity of this color, with a higher percentage indicating a more vivid and pure color. The Lightness value of 54% determines the brightness of the color, where a higher percentage represents a lighter shade. Together, these HSL values combine to create the distinctive shade of red that is both moderately vivid and fairly bright, as indicated by the specific values for this color. The HSL color model is particularly useful in digital arts and web design, as it allows for easy adjustments of color tones, saturation, and brightness levels.
